  • "Phone is fine. Poor communication of information."
    on by 5RMR

    Pros Easy to set up and use. Has more features than I need for simply making and receiving calls.

    Cons Lack of details about the service and charges applied by AT&T.

    Summary Things you should know: I recently purchased an AT&T Gophone from Best Buy. I bought the $100 for 1,000 minutes yearly plan (equals $0.10 per minute). I discovered, after I made my first few calls, that the length of the call noted on the phone does not correspond to the charges applied by AT&T. I made 3 calls, each of which was noted on my phone as having been under 1 minute in length. However, AT&T charged me $0.20 for each call. When I spoke later to customer service (and later verified by a stop at a local AT&T store), AT&T charges from the moment you hit the "send" button, while the phone records only the length of the actual call.

    Also, when trying to reach AT&T customer service via the provided 800-901-9878 number, no option was provided for talking with a live person and none of the prerecorded messages answered my questions. Only after an online search did I discover the trick - when you call the 800-number and the message begins to play, hit "0" (you may have to do this more than once) to get to a live person.

    AT&T could have done a much better job of explaining the charges on their website and on the phone packaging and in the instruction manual. The phone and the service seem to be fine, but the lack of pertinent information is very distressing.

  • "Good Basic Flip Phone"
    on by boater7

    Pros *Low price.
    *Good sound quality.
    *Long battery life.
    *Lightweight/Small.

    Cons *Most annoying: if you press the "OK" button from the home screen it goes to att.net. If you don't immediately exit, you'll be changed for web access.
    *Camera is okay, but not good.
    *Unwanted extras: YP Mobile, Mobile Web, IM, AT&T Social

    Summary This is a good basic flip phone - a good choice if you are seeking an affordable phone for making calls and texting. I've been using it for 2 months and am happy with the purchase.
